MURRAY MOTOR VEH. OP. LIC. CASE


203 Pa.Super. 418 (1964)

Murray Motor Vehicle Operator License Case.

Superior Court of Pennsylvania.

June 11, 1964.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Elmer T. Bolla, Deputy Attorney General, with him Walter E. Alessandroni, Attorney General, for Commonwealth, appellant.

J.F. O'Malley, with him Yost & O'Malley, for appellee.

Patrick A. Gleason, for appellees.

R. Thomas Strayer, for appellee.

Before ERVIN, WRIGHT, WOODSIDE, WATKINS, MONTGOMERY, and FLOOD, JJ. (RHODES, P.J., absent).


OPINION BY WOODSIDE, J., June 11, 1964:

These are other appeals by the Commonwealth, each from an order entered by Judge SHETTIG for the Court of Common Pleas of Cambria County reversing the order of the Secretary of Revenue suspending an operator's license. The court below was of the opinion that the radar warning signs did not meet the requirements of The Vehicle Code of April 29, 1959, P.L. 58, § 1002...
